<p>Joshua tree forest in the Inyo Mountains near Eureka Valley.</p>
<p>At the end of my January 2012 visit to Death Valley National Park, I exited to the north, stopping for an evening and a morning at the Eureka Valley Dunes, and then heading out to the north via Big Pine Road. This was my first drive across this route, so I got to see some brand new (to me) California territory. The drive began by retracing the route along the gravel road to the dunes, then rejoined the main road &#8211; still gravel &#8211; coming up from the Park. This road was in great shape, well graded and wide, as it headed up Eureka Valley before turning to head up into the Inyo Mountains.</p>
<p>After entering the Inyos, it isn&#8217;t very long before pavement resumes &#8211; which is a welcome thing at this point, since I had been almost entirely on gravel roads, some badly washboarded, for something like 65 miles or more at this point. As the road climbed out of Eureka Valley and up a mountain canyon it soon passed through a fairly large joshua tree forest. Since I hadn&#8217;t eaten yet today and it was now past mid-morning, I took this as an opportunity to stop for some breakfast/lunch and to photograph these fascinating trees, here stretching across waves of sage and brush covered hills backed by higher hills that were still in shadow.</p>
